Conjure Tools
During one of my recent expeditions, I seem to have accidentally discovered a way to manipulate matter itself using media. Specifically the creation of it, or rather the illusion of reforming air particles around me. However, doing so is incredibly difficult, and so I have devised a simple method to make it easier.
By focusing on a mere concept, such as a tool of some sorts, the media seems to do the rest. I've appropriately named these concepts 'wishes'.
Each wish seems to cost the same amount of media, about a tenth of an amethyst dust per point of durability, plus an extra 2.
Miner's Wish (player, number →)
Accepts a player entity and a number. A pickaxe will then be conjured and given to the target, using the value put in as its durability.
Lumberjack's Wish (player, number →)
Accepts a player entity and a number. An axe will then be conjured and given to the target, using the value put in as its durability.
Fighter's Wish (player, number →)
Accepts a player entity and a number. A sword will then be conjured and given to the target, using the value put in as its durability.
Terraformer's Wish (player, number →)
Accepts a player entity and a number. A shovel will then be conjured and given to the target, using the value put in as its durability.
Farmer's Wish (player, number →)
Accepts a player entity and a number. A scythe will then be conjured and given to the target, using the value put in as its durability.
